Analyzing User Behavior for Optimal App Design
To craft compelling and successful applications, developers must delve into the intricate world of user behavior. By observing how users interact your app, you can uncover valuable insights that guide design decisions. Through careful measurement of user actions, such as screen navigation, interaction frequency, and completion rates, designers can acquire a detailed understanding of user needs and preferences. This knowledge is crucial for improving the app experience, making it more accessible.
- Utilizing A/B testing allows developers to contrast different design variations and determine the most impactful solution.
- Surveys from users can offer invaluable insights into their thoughts with the app.
Dominating the Art of Cross-Platform Development
In today's rapidly evolving technological landscape, engineers are constantly seeking to create applications that can target a wide audience. This is where cross-platform development comes into play, presenting a powerful method for building software that seamlessly performs across multiple operating systems.
- Leveraging the right tools and technologies is crucial for successful cross-platform development.
- Popular frameworks such as React Native and Flutter support developers to craft native-like experiences on diverse platforms.
- A deep understanding of different operating systems and their specificities is essential.
By mastering the art of cross-platform development, developers can broaden their reach, streamline development processes, and ultimately deliver exceptional user experiences across a global user pool.
